Early Life and Career Beginnings
Hugh Dillon, born on May 31, 1963, in Kingston, Ontario, Canada, is a versatile Canadian talent known for his work as both an actor and a musician. Growing up in a working-class family, Dillon discovered his passion for music at a young age, eventually forming the punk rock band "Headstones" in the late 1980s. The band quickly gained popularity in the Canadian music scene, establishing Dillon as a prominent figure in the industry.
Acting Career and Breakthrough
Dillon's foray into acting began in the 1990s, where he landed roles in various television series and films. However, it was his portrayal of volatile rocker Billy Tallent in the critically acclaimed film "Hard Core Logo" (1996) that brought him widespread recognition and praise for his intense and authentic performance. This role marked the beginning of Dillon's successful acting career, leading to numerous opportunities in both film and television.
